Degradation of current year EV batteries is almost a non issue. The quality and robustness of EV batteries are way higher than phone/tablet/laptop batteries. They did a study of over 500 Tesla vehicles in the USA, and found that in the first 50,000 miles of the vehicle, the battery degraded by 5% and after that almost nothing at all.

Even if the battery failed outside its warranty period(8-10 years and 100k-150k over here), the prices have dropped dramatically to around $150/KWH to replace. By the time it did come for you to replace, its estimated prices would be $80-$100/KWH.
Just because the battery fails, does not mean the cells need replacing, thats actually quite rare.
There are many instances of EV's here with 300,000+ miles on the original battery, with 0-15% degradation.

Another plus of modern day EV's is their reliability. Electric motors are far less prone to problems than gas/diesel engines. Virtually no moving parts means far less potential problems.

But range is the real issue. Your not going to be able to drive the distant specified on vehicle with a fully charged battery. If it says 250, you can expect 180-200, depending on road conditions, traffic etc. Most EV's dont even have that kind of range.

In Britain you are lucky, already a ton of charging stations. Takes about 40 minutes to fast charge a tesla to 80%, 20 minutes for 50%. So if you plan things right, you can be eating lunch on a long trip whilst your car charges.
